KW T800
tRYING TO FIND THE PROBLEM WITH MY FRONT RIGHT TURN SIGNAL STAYING LIT. THE SISNAL LIGHT INDICATOR ON THE DASH ALSO STAYS LIT

That sounds like a bad turn signal switch to me. If you have an ohmeter, unplug the switch. The blue wire should be hot and the red wire should be the right front signal. See if there is continuity between them two. There shouldn't be.
When you unplug the switch see if the light goes out and report back.

try checking the bulbs in all the plugs on the right side...one may be corroded or rusted in the plug causing a short. i had a T-6 that did the same thing and found out i had a rusted light socket.
